WebDecision trees are trained by passing data down from a root node to leaves. The data is repeatedly split according to predictor variables so that child nodes are more “pure” (i.e., homogeneous) in terms of the outcome variable. This process is illustrated below: The root node begins with all the training data. Splitting is a term used in psychiatry to describe the inability to hold opposing thoughts, feelings, or beliefs. Some might say that a person who splits sees the world in terms of black or white—all or nothing. See more Splitting can interfere with relationships and lead to intense and self-destructive behaviors. Every irreducible polynomial p ∈ F[X] with some root α ∈ K splits completely in K. Proof. simplot soil builders idahoWebCoupling in 13 C NMR spectra. Because the 13 C isotope is present at only 1.1% natural abundance, the probability of finding two adjacent 13 C carbons in the same molecule of a compound is very low.
